
Liverpool have had a change of heart in relation to one of their transfer targets as Arne Slot makes an apparent U-turn on a European star.
The Reds’ season is in danger of flatlining after the champions dropped points again in midweek following their draw at home to Sunderland, leaving Slot’s side in ninth place over a third of the way into the campaign.
With Liverpool trailing Premier League leaders Arsenal by 11 points ahead of their trip to Leeds United, their Dutch boss would be forgiven for mulling over big changes in the transfer market as the January window approaches.
And according to a recent claim from Bild, it appears that there has been an element of indecision over who might be able to help save their season.
While it has been reported that Liverpool have long been admirers of Bayern Munich winger Michael Olise, it seemed as though the links had gone cold, with Bild previously claiming that the Reds had ‘backed away’ from pursuing the Frenchman.
However, after a fresh ‘twist’, this may not be the case, with Bild’s deputy football editor, Tobias Altschaffl, hinting that Olise is indeed on the Reds’ transfer radar after all.
According to Altschaffl, Olise may only be on a “backup” list at Anfield, but this U-turn could point to a lack of organisation behind the scenes – a far cry from the laser-focused transfer policy Michael Edwards oversaw at the height of Jurgen Klopp’s successes on Merseyside.
To add weight to this, there doesn’t even seem to be a realistic chance of luring the ex-Crystal Palace ace to the club.
Altschaffl claimed (as per Sport Witness): “Michael Olise is on this backup list.
“Bayern are very confident that Olise won’t leave. Why would they let him go? But it’s understandable that Liverpool are interested in him.”
Altschaffl’s scepticism over a deal appears to be well-founded, with Bayern flying under Vincent Kompany this season in an almost faultless campaign to date.
The Bavarians have won 11 out of 12 Bundesliga games and came unstuck against Arsenal in the Champions League in late November – their first defeat since July’s Club World Cup campaign.
Olise has been at the heart of their red-hot form, too – recording 20 goal involvements in 21 games, including five in their 6-2 demolition of Freiburg last month.
Given Liverpool’s indifferent form this term, it would be one hell of a sales pitch to get the 13-cap star on board.
